.elementor-widget-container .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-container .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-617 .elementor-element.elementor-element-6ec79ad{--display:flex;--min-height:0px;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:center;--gap:0px 0px;--row-gap:0px;--column-gap:0px;}.elementor-widget-eael-dual-color-header .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-eael-dual-color-header .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-eael-dual-color-header .eael-dch-separator-wrap i{color:var( --e-global-color-primary );}.elementor-617 .elementor-element.elementor-element-9141ef9 .eael-dual-header .title{color:#4d4d4d;}.elementor-617 .elementor-element.elementor-element-9141ef9 .eael-dual-header .title span.lead{color:#9401D9;}.elementor-617 .elementor-element.elementor-element-9141ef9 .eael-dual-header .subtext{color:#4d4d4d;}.elementor-617 .elementor-element.elementor-element-9141ef9 .eael-dch-separator-wrap{justify-content:center;}.elementor-617 .elementor-element.elementor-element-9141ef9 .eael-dch-separator-wrap .separator-one{margin-right:0px;width:85%;height:5px;}.elementor-617 .elementor-element.elementor-element-9141ef9 .eael-dch-separator-wrap .separator-two{margin-left:0px;width:15%;height:5px;}.elementor-617 .elementor-element.elementor-element-1fb4b70{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:flex-end;--gap:0px 0px;--row-gap:0px;--column-gap:0px;}.elementor-widget-eael-breadcrumbs .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-eael-breadcrumbs .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-617 .elementor-element.elementor-element-678f477 .eael-breadcrumbs .eael-breadcrumbs__content{background-color:#f8f8fa;}.elementor-617 .elementor-element.elementor-element-678f477 .eael-breadcrumbs .eael-breadcrumb-separator svg path{fill:#A5A4B0;}.elementor-617 .elementor-element.elementor-element-678f477 .eael-breadcrumbs .eael-breadcrumb-separator{color:#A5A4B0;margin:0 10px;}.elementor-617 .elementor-element.elementor-element-678f477 .eael-breadcrumbs .eael-breadcrumb-separator svg{width:15px;height:15px;}.elementor-617 .elementor-element.elementor-element-678f477 .eael-breadcrumbs .eael-breadcrumb-separator i{font-size:15px;}.elementor-617 .elementor-element.elementor-element-678f477 .eael-breadcrumbs .eael-breadcrumb-separator svg, 
					.elementor-617 .elementor-element.elementor-element-678f477 .eael-breadcrumbs .eael-breadcrumb-separator i{margin:4px 0px 0px 0px;}.elementor-617 .elementor-element.elementor-element-07790cd{--display:flex;--min-height:2px;--gap:0px 0px;--row-gap:0px;--column-gap:0px;}.elementor-widget-html .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-html .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-617 .elementor-element.elementor-element-c364f15{width:var( --container-widget-width, 1200px );max-width:1200px;--container-widget-width:1200px;--container-widget-flex-grow:0;}.elementor-617 .elementor-element.elementor-element-45d744d{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;}.elementor-617 .elementor-element.elementor-element-a552433{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-617 .elementor-element.elementor-element-a552433.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-617 .elementor-element.elementor-element-cadb756{width:var( --container-widget-width, 96.527% );max-width:96.527%;--container-widget-width:96.527%;--container-widget-flex-grow:0;}.elementor-617 .elementor-element.elementor-element-cadb756.elementor-element{--flex-grow:0;--flex-shrink:0;}.elementor-617 .elementor-element.elementor-element-1379374{--display:flex;--min-height:100vh;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-617 .elementor-element.elementor-element-1379374.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-617 .elementor-element.elementor-element-277e250{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-617 .elementor-element.elementor-element-277e250.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-widget-eael-wpforms .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-eael-wpforms .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-eael-wpforms .eael-contact-form-description, .elementor-widget-eael-wpforms .wpforms-description{font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-widget-eael-wpforms .eael-wpforms .wpforms-field label, .elementor-widget-eael-wpforms .eael-wpforms .wpforms-field legend{font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-widget-eael-wpforms .eael-wpforms .wpforms-field input:not([type=radio]):not([type=checkbox]):not([type=submit]):not([type=button]):not([type=image]):not([type=file]), .elementor-widget-eael-wpforms .eael-wpforms .wpforms-field textarea, .elementor-widget-eael-wpforms .eael-wpforms .wpforms-field select{font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-widget-eael-wpforms .eael-wpforms .wpforms-submit-container .wpforms-submit{font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-617 .elementor-element.elementor-element-9ff19a5 .eael-wpforms label.wpforms-error{display:block !important;}.elementor-617 .elementor-element.elementor-element-9ff19a5 .eael-wpforms .wpforms-field input:not([type=radio]):not([type=checkbox]):not([type=submit]):not([type=button]):not([type=image]):not([type=file]), .elementor-617 .elementor-element.elementor-element-9ff19a5 .eael-wpforms .wpforms-field select{height:30px;}.elementor-617 .elementor-element.elementor-element-9ff19a5 .eael-wpforms .wpforms-submit-container{text-align:center;}.elementor-617 .elementor-element.elementor-element-9ff19a5 .eael-wpforms .wpforms-submit-container .wpforms-submit{display:inline-block;width:155px;font-family:"nanum-square-neo", Sans-serif;font-weight:600;}.elementor-617 .elementor-element.elementor-element-9ff19a5 .eael-wpforms .wpforms-submit-container .wpforms-submit:hover, 
                    .elementor-617 .elementor-element.elementor-element-9ff19a5 .eael-wpforms .wpforms-container-full .wpforms-submit-container .wpforms-form button[type=submit]:hover{background:#065689 !important;}.elementor-617 .elementor-element.elementor-element-9ff19a5 .eael-wpforms input.wpforms-error{border-width:1px;}.elementor-617 .elementor-element.elementor-element-9ff19a5 .eael-wpforms textarea.wpforms-error{border-width:1px;}@media(min-width:768px){.elementor-617 .elementor-element.elementor-element-6ec79ad{--content-width:1200px;}.elementor-617 .elementor-element.elementor-element-1fb4b70{--content-width:1200px;}.elementor-617 .elementor-element.elementor-element-07790cd{--content-width:1200px;}.elementor-617 .elementor-element.elementor-element-45d744d{--content-width:1200px;}.elementor-617 .elementor-element.elementor-element-a552433{--width:25%;}.elementor-617 .elementor-element.elementor-element-1379374{--width:1%;}.elementor-617 .elementor-element.elementor-element-277e250{--width:74%;}}/* Start Custom Fonts CSS */@font-face {
	font-family: 'nanum-square-neo';
	font-display: auto;
	src: url('http://safetysupport.co.kr/wp-content/uploads/2025/07/NanumSquareNeo-Variable.ttf') format('truetype');
}
/* End Custom Fonts CSS */